摘要
The vibrational energy transfer between the (100) and (001) Coriolis-coupled states of ozone has been investigated in O3-M gas mixtures (M=O2, N2 and argon) by means of a double-resonance technique using two CO2 lasers. From the rate constants, measured as a function of the molar fraction of O3 in the gas mixtures, the rate coefficients have been deduced for the process involving O3-O3 collisions, i.e. {A figure is presented} = (2.18±0.11) × 106 s-1 Torr-1, and for the process involving O3-M collisions, i.e. {A figure is presented} = k1-3 Ar = (0.32±0.08) × 106 s-1 Torr-1 and {A figure is presented} = (0.36±0.08) × 106 s-1 Torr-1. © 1990.
